Замена int main() на bool main()

Функция main() является входной точкой программы на языках программирования C и C++. Обычно она имеет тип int и возвращает целочисленное значение, указывающее на успешное или неуспешное завершение программы. Однако, недавние исследования показали, что замена типа возвращаемого значения с int на bool может иметь ряд преимуществ и дать дополнительные возможности.

Одной из основных целей замены int main() на bool main() является улучшение читаемости и понятности кода. Тип bool имеет всего два возможных значения: true и false. Это может значительно упростить понимание кода и его логику. Например, если main() возвращает true, это означает успешное выполнение программы, а возвращение false указывает на ошибку или неуспешное завершение.

Еще одним преимуществом замены типа возвращаемого значения является возможность использования операторов или (

Оцените статью